初探json【eclipse】 json的概念 使用ajax向Servlet发送请求返回数据 使用Gson工具转换对象 json在html页面中的应用

1. JSON是JavaScript Object Notation 的缩写,是JS提供的一种数据交换格式。

2. SON对象本质上就是一个JS对象,但是这个对象比较特殊,它可以直接转换为字符串,在不同语言中进行传递,通过工具又可以转换为其他语言中的对象。

json的类型

1. 字符串

  例子:”aaa”

  注意:不能使用单引号

2. 数字:

  例子:123.4

3. 布尔值:

  例子:true、false

4.  null值:

  例子:null

5. 对象

  例子:{“name”:”sunwukong”, ”age”:18}

6. 数组

  例子:[1,”str”,true]

使用ajax向Servlet发送请求返回数据

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

使用Gson工具转换对象

这里需要导包

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

json在html页面中的应用

导包

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

 

Sverlet端编写取数据的逻辑程序

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

Html端编写接收逻辑

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用

Body体数据

 初探json【eclipse】
json的概念
使用ajax向Servlet发送请求返回数据
使用Gson工具转换对象
json在html页面中的应用